Converting Watts to surface Lux

To find the target surface illuminance in lux ($lx$) produced by electrical wattage power, first multiply the watts by the bulb efficacy ($\eta$, lm/W) to get overall light flux in lumens. Then divide lumens by surface area in square meters:

$$E_{lx} = \frac{P_W \times \eta}{A_{m^2}}$$

Where $\eta$ is the light bulb efficacy. For example, a 10W LED with 90 lm/W efficacy generates 900 lm, producing 45 lx over a 20 m² area.
